GARLIC (Allium Sativum) EXTRACT EFFECTIVENESS TEST AGAINST TRICHOPHYTON RUBRUM AND PITYROSPORUM OVALE MUSHROOM

Yohana Christiani Marpaung, Adeline Adeline, Andre Budi, Grace Alvonsine

Abstract


Seborrheic dermatitis and dandruff are chronic papulo squama skin disorders. with a predilection for areas rich in sebum glands, scalp, face and body. Tinea corporis itself is a dermatophytosis in area of the body skin that has no hair (glabrous skin). In general, itchy rashes are found on the body, extremities or face. Methods: this type of research is experirnental then the research design uses the disc diffusion method with the Posttest Only Control Group Design. Each treatment for 1 mushroom was repeated 4 times, thus the total sample for 2 mushrooms was 16 samples. The extract concentration was made into 4 concentration, namely 15%, 30%, 45%, 60% and positive control (ketokenazole) then the inhibition test was carried out on both fungi, namely Trychophyton rubrum and Pityrosporum ovale using PDA (Potato Dextrose Agar) media.  Results: The research showed that garlic ethanol extract could inhibit fungal growth at concentrations of 15%, 30%, 45%, 60% and positive control (ketokenazole) with an average diameter of the inhibitory zone power test for Trychophyton rubrum 6.85mm, 7.00mm.  , 7.50mm, 8.35mm, and 12.30mm.  And for the power test the inhibition zones of Pityrosporum ovale were 6.50mm, 11.50mm,12.40mm,15.00mm, and 20.50mm.  Conclusion: The conclusion of this study shows that garlic extract has the power to slow down the growth of the fungi Trychophyton rubrum and Pityrosporum ovale in concentrate 60% is 15,00mm and 8,35mm.
